What is Handwriting Recognition?
Handwriting recognition refers to the technological ability to identify and interpret handwritten characters and text. This process involves the conversion of handwritten input into machine-readable data, enabling computers and devices to understand and process human handwriting. Handwriting recognition systems utilize various algorithms and machine learning techniques to analyze the strokes and patterns of handwriting, making it a crucial component in fields such as artificial intelligence and human-computer interaction.
How Does Handwriting Recognition Work?
The functioning of handwriting recognition systems typically involves two main stages: preprocessing and recognition. During preprocessing, the system cleans and normalizes the input data, which may include removing noise, correcting slant, and segmenting individual characters or words. In the recognition stage, advanced algorithms analyze the processed data to match it against known patterns of handwriting, utilizing techniques such as neural networks and deep learning to enhance accuracy and efficiency.
Types of Handwriting Recognition
There are primarily two types of handwriting recognition: online and offline. Online handwriting recognition occurs in real-time as the user writes on a digital device, capturing the strokes and pressure applied. Offline handwriting recognition, on the other hand, involves analyzing scanned images of handwritten text, requiring more complex algorithms to interpret the static data. Each type has its applications, with online recognition being widely used in tablets and smartphones, while offline recognition is common in document digitization.
Applications of Handwriting Recognition
Handwriting recognition technology has a wide array of applications across various sectors. In education, it facilitates the grading of handwritten exams and the digitization of notes. In healthcare, it aids in the transcription of patient records and prescriptions. Additionally, handwriting recognition is employed in banking for processing checks and in legal fields for digitizing handwritten documents, showcasing its versatility and importance in modern workflows.
Challenges in Handwriting Recognition
Despite advancements, handwriting recognition still faces several challenges. Variability in individual handwriting styles, the presence of cursive writing, and the influence of different writing instruments can hinder accuracy. Moreover, recognizing handwriting in different languages and scripts adds another layer of complexity. Researchers are continually working on improving algorithms to address these challenges and enhance the reliability of handwriting recognition systems.
Technological Advancements in Handwriting Recognition
Recent developments in artificial intelligence and machine learning have significantly improved handwriting recognition capabilities. The integration of deep learning techniques, particularly convolutional neural networks (CNNs), has led to higher accuracy rates in recognizing complex handwriting patterns. Additionally, advancements in natural language processing (NLP) have enabled systems to better understand context, further enhancing the recognition process and making it more user-friendly.
Future Trends in Handwriting Recognition
The future of handwriting recognition is promising, with ongoing research focused on increasing accuracy and expanding its applications. Innovations such as real-time translation of handwritten text and integration with augmented reality (AR) are on the horizon. Furthermore, as more data becomes available for training machine learning models, we can expect handwriting recognition systems to become more adaptive and capable of learning from user interactions, leading to a more personalized experience.
Handwriting Recognition vs. Typing
While typing has been the dominant method of text input for decades, handwriting recognition offers unique advantages. It allows for a more natural and intuitive way of inputting information, particularly for those who prefer writing by hand. Handwriting recognition can capture the nuances of a person’s writing style, making it a valuable tool for creative tasks such as note-taking, sketching, and brainstorming. As technology evolves, the integration of both methods may provide users with a seamless experience.
Impact of Handwriting Recognition on Society
The impact of handwriting recognition technology on society is profound. It has transformed how we interact with digital devices, making information more accessible and facilitating communication. By enabling the digitization of handwritten documents, it has contributed to the preservation of historical texts and the efficiency of modern workflows. As handwriting recognition continues to evolve, it will likely play an increasingly important role in bridging the gap between human expression and digital technology.